    body {
        background-image: url('stars.gif');
        background-size: 200px;
    }

@media (min-width: 700px) {


    .navbar {
        display: flex;
        flex-direction: row;
        justify-content: space-evenly;
        margin: 2%;

    }

    .navbar .logo img {
        margin: 2%;
        min-width: 220px;
        width: 35%;
    }

    .navbar .navlayers {
        display: flex;
        flex-direction: column;
        color:white;
        font-family: 'comic-sans';
        font-size: large;
        align-content: right;

    }

    .navbar .navlayers .navbuttons {
        display: flex;
        flex-direction: row;
        justify-content: space-between;
    }

    .navbar .navlayers .navbuttons a:link {
        color: white;
        text-decoration: none;
    }

    .navbar .navlayers .navbuttons a:visited {
        color: white;
        text-decoration: none;
    }

    .navbar .navlayers .navbuttons a:hover {
        color: lightblue;
        text-decoration: none;
        font-style: italic;
    }


    .navbar .navlayers .navbuttons .individualbuttons {
        display: inline-block;
        white-space: nowrap;
        margin: 0.5rem 1rem;
        padding: 0.5rem 1rem;
        background-color: rgb(65, 0, 139);
        font-family: 'Comic Sans MS', 'Trebuchet MS';
        border-radius: 25%;
    }


}


@media (max-width: 700px) {


    .navbar {
        display: flex;
        flex-direction: row;
        justify-content: space-evenly;
        margin: 2%;

    }

    .navbar .logo img {
        margin: 2%;
        min-width: 220px;
        width: 35%;
    }

    .navbar .navlayers {
        display: flex;
        flex-direction: column;
        color:white;
        font-family: 'comic-sans';
        font-size: large;
        align-content: right;

    }

    .navbar .navlayers .navbuttons {
        display: flex;
        flex-direction: column;
        justify-content: space-between;
    }

    .navbar .navlayers .navbuttons a:link {
        color: white;
        text-decoration: none;
    }

    .navbar .navlayers .navbuttons a:visited {
        color: white;
        text-decoration: none;
    }

    .navbar .navlayers .navbuttons a:hover {
        color: lightblue;
        text-decoration: none;
        font-style: italic;
    }


    .navbar .navlayers .navbuttons .individualbuttons {
        display: inline-block;
        white-space: nowrap;
        margin: 0.5rem 1rem;
        padding: 0.5rem 1rem;
        background-color: rgb(65, 0, 139);
        font-family: 'Comic Sans MS', 'Trebuchet MS';
        border-radius: 25%;
    }


}






    .policytext {
        display: block;
        color: white;
        margin-left: 2%;
        margin-right: 2%;
        padding: 1%;
        background-color: black;
        font-family: 'Trebuchet MS';
    }